Blown away by the sounds that were emerging from the after-hours in the city of Montreal. Luke decided to pursue the interest of buying vinyl simply as a hobby. After six months of collecting he started working at one of Montrealýs most well known record shop Tabou International DJ (a forefront of the dance scene here in Montreal that started selling house in 1982) As a fresh new face in the scene, he became one of their sellers in the house department and within time became a buyer for the store while continuing to sell and write endless reviews and write-ups for their new releases. After two and a half years of working at Tabou and indulging in his DJ hobby for three, he moved on to work for inbeatmusic.com an affiliate of Inbeat where he wrote the majority of reviews for a part of their website.
While also staying busy with his full time studies at University, it was in 2004 where he found his home in music. Younan Music: A digital label for a digital world started by friend and colleague Saeed Younan. Luke was proud to join on board with Saeed and help spread the sounds of YM, while working on several and different areas for the label and website. Working with Saeed also found him in Miami for the first time for the 20th anniversary of the Winter Music Conference held in South Beach giving him the first taste and feeling of what it is like to attend and be a part of an international event. With being a part of the label, he is definitely looking forward to what the future will bring him.
Furthermore, Luke is also best known for his popular online show Native Love with Luke Native. A Thursday afternoon tradition from 2 PM - 5 PM EST having already featured some of Montrealýs most respected House DJs along with the occasional International guest. Having just recently celebrated his 2-year anniversary of Native Love his show was also voted as an honorable mention for Best Local Radio show as voted by the readers of the Montreal Mirror newspaper. After being a part of a Toronto based website for his show he moved his show to Montreal based site Techno.fm where friends and fellow listeners can check out what he likes to call deep, dirty, sleazy, groovy, funky, vocal with a touch of prog house.
